Gustavo Sauer has been the standout performer for Wuhan Three Towns in league play this season with a rating of 7.51. Jhonder Cádiz and Kilian Bevis have also impressed with ratings of 7.43 and 6.97 respectively.
Jhonder Cádiz leads Wuhan Three Towns's scoring in league play with 12 goals this season. Gustavo Sauer has contributed 5, while Kilian Bevis has added 3.
Gustavo Sauer is the chief creator for Wuhan Three Towns in league play with 4 assists this season. Jhonder Cádiz and Kilian Bevis have also been key playmakers with 4 and 3 assists respectively.
Wuhan Three Towns have been in a period of stalemates recently, winning 0 of their last 5 matches (0% win rate). They have scored 6 goals and conceded 7 during this period. In the Super League, they faced a 2-2 draw with Shanghai Shenhua, a 3-3 draw with Shandong Taishan, a 1-1 draw with Yunnan Yukun, and a 0-1 loss to Beijing Guoan. In the Cup, they faced a 0-0 draw with Qingdao Red Lions.

Ricardo Soares is the current head coach of Wuhan Three Towns. Under their leadership, the team has achieved a 0% win rate across 3 matches, averaging 0.67 points per game.
Notable previous managers include Benjamín Mora managed the club for one season, recording 2 wins from 13 matches (15% win rate). Filipe Martins managed the club for one season, recording 0 wins from 5 matches (0% win rate). Other former coaches include Zhuoxiang Deng, Ricardo Rodríguez, Pedro Morilla, and Tsutomu Takahata.
Wuhan Three Towns plays their home matches at Wuhan Sports Center Stadium in Wuhan, which has a capacity of 54,357.
